November 25, 201213 yr Author 30 (from 33) P!nk - Try [D] http://ecx.images-amazon.com/images/I/61z13W1uS2L._AA160_.jpg Chart Run: 60-45-40-33-30 [5 wks] Format: download only single Label: RCA Records Label Although Pink rose to prominence as an R&B singer in the classic '90s LaFace mould, a front displayed on her debut CAN'T TAKE ME HOME, it was when she took control of her own image in 2001 that she truly became an icon. While the Linda Perry (4 Non Blondes) composed hit "Get This Party Started" strayed not all that far from her initial dance-pop path, the remainder of M!SSUNDAZTOOD revealed an artist schooled in the punk tradition. Further recordings wandered down multiple paths, cementing Pink's reputation as a genre-bending pop songstress. - HMV Video here: yTCDVfMz15M Chart history (Year peak title): 2000 06 There You Go -1- 2000 05 Most Girls -2- 2001 09 You Make Me Sick -3- 2001 01 Lady Marmalade (Christina Aguilera, Lil' Kim, Mya & P!nk) -OST- 2002 02 Get The Party Started -1- 2002 06 Don't Let Me Get Me -2- 2002 01 Just Like A Pill -3- 2002 11 Family Portrait -4- 2003 03 Feel Good Time (P!nk Feat.
